02 — A SAMPLE NEWCASTLE QUOTE

What a Newcastle rendering quote looks like.

Indicative, Newcastle-priced line items. Your walkthrough produces a quote in this exact format — itemised, GST-correct, tradie-reviewed.

Surface prep & repairHack off drummy sections, clean and stabilise the substrate, patch and bond ready for new render.
$970
Two-coat cement renderScratch and float coats to brick or blockwork, screeded straight ready for finish.
$3,920
Acrylic texture finishColoured acrylic topcoat (sand or trowel finish) over rendered or blueboard substrate.
$3,100
Scaffold hire & setupMobile or modular scaffold for safe two-storey access, including erect and dismantle.
$1,430
Sheet cladding (where specified)Supply and fix fibre-cement or composite cladding sheets with battens and flashings.
$2,650
Indicative total inc. GST
Newcastle pricing · around the national average · confirmed on your walkthrough
$13,273

How much does a render job cost in Newcastle in 2026?

Newcastle rendering quotes typically land between $2,550 and $18,360, depending on scope and finish. Local pricing runs around the national average, so the same scope in another city may quote differently. A representative job comes in around $13,273 including GST.
